One of the key questions for analyzing audience is: Did the author choose a subject that is of interest of a particular group of

people?
True or False??

The correct answer is true.

It is true that one of the key questions for analyzing audience is: Did the author choose a subject that is of interest of a particular group of people.

To create an interesting story, the author should know what appeals to its audience, what worries them, what excites them, what could move them to do something. It could be the environment, business, sports, recreation, or inspirational topics. So yes, the author needs to know who are going to be the recipients of your research to make a better impact.
